Equipped with Quantum Dot Technology, this TV unleashes a massive spectrum of a billion shades of color. A crisp 240Hz motionrate banishes blur and smooth’s out the picture for more fluid action. It even looks great when you’re not watching at all, thanks to Ambient Mode +.

the “polarizing film” on the screen looks like a temporary/protective film, not essential to its function. i searched product specs, manual, and virtual support assistant but found no information before mistakenly attempted to remove it thereby damaging my new tv. samsung evidently will not cover it under warranty.

1st off back panel of tv was loose. it was brand new but…. i guess ya never know.
picture compared to last years model is horrible. there is a rainbowish hue that is so bothering to me despite every calibration i did. so i decided to return it after 5 days.
local dimming feature and backlight are no longer available compared to last years model.
why would the latest tv in the series lose these features?

We love this T.V. Amazing picture, with great anti-glare characteristics. It does great in any sort of room lighting, but really shines in a bright and sunny room because of both its color brightness and anti-glare characteristics. The only knock in our book, and it is very minor, is that it is all black in is bezel and legs. A little bit of metal would give it a much more premium look, which given his T.V.s cost, is certainly justified. Would like to add a second one in our living room at our house.
